Genoa President Enrico Preziosi claims Aurelio De Laurentiis, not Maurizio Sarri, was to blame for Napoli missing out on Mattia Perin.

Genoa sporting director Giorgio Perinetti claimed over the weekend that Sarri wanted a goalkeeper with ‘better feet’ than Perin, who has since joined Juventus, but Preziosi made it clear who the buck lay with.

“Sarri didn’t want Perin? No, it wasn’t like that,” he told 7 Gold.

“The problem is that with it’s very difficult to deal with Aurelio De Laurentiis and the Azzurri board. For this reason, we struggled to close a deal.

“Juventus, on the other hand, showed a strong desire for the player, so the goalkeeper went to Turin.

“Mandragora? We like him and he interests us. We’ll talk to Juventus. Stuaro? It’s a bit more complicated with him.”
